What is ETANIDAZOLE?

The Uses of ETANIDAZOLE

Etanidazole is a kind of hypoxic radiosensitizer (a drug that sensitizes tumour cells to radiation therapy). Etanidazole is used in conjunction with Paclitaxel (P132500) to treat glioma, and is also used with Carboplatin (C177500) to treat advanced ovarian cancer.

The Uses of ETANIDAZOLE

Antineoplastic (hypoxic cell radiosensitizer).

Definition

ChEBI: A monocarboxylic acid amide obtained by formal condensation of the carboxy group of (2-nitro-1H-imidazol-1-yl)acetic acid with the amino group of ethanolamine. Used as a radiosensitising agent for hypoxic tumour cells.

brand name

Radinyl (Roberts Pharmaceutical).

Properties of ETANIDAZOLE

Melting point: 162-163° (Beaman); mp 164.5-165° (Lee)
Boiling point: 354.3°C (rough estimate)
Density  1.4480 (rough estimate)
refractive index  1.6700 (estimate)
storage temp.  2-8°C
solubility  Acetone (Slightly), Methanol (Slightly)
form  Solid
pka 13.74±0.46(Predicted)
color  White to Off-White
Stability: Hygroscopic
